Курсовая работа: Разработка прикладного программного обеспечения отдела кадров университета

Rem Фамилия

If rec!Family <> "" Then

.TextBox1.Text = rec!Family

.Caption = .Caption & rec!Family

Else TextBox1.Text = ""

End If

Такие компоненты, как ComboBox заполняются данными из отдельных таблиц. Например, список кафедр заполняется в ComboBox1:

Rem Составляем список кафедр

DopRec.Open ("Select * from tblDepartament") 'Получаем все кафедры

For i = 0 To DopRec.RecordCount - 1 'Проходим по всем записям

.ComboBox1.AddItem (DopRec!Departament) 'Добавляем запись в ComboBox1

DopRec.MoveNext 'Переходим к следующей записи

Next i

Rem Выбор Кафедры

If (Not rec!DepartamentID = 0) Then 'Если в поле кафедры есть значение

.ComboBox1.ListIndex = rec!DepartamentID - 1 'Выбираем его номер в списке

Else 'Иначе

.ComboBox1.ListIndex = -1 'Ничего не выбираем

End If

DopRec.Close


Также из этой формы открывается дополнительное окно, которое содержит информацию о трудовой книжке сотрудника. Эта информация также получается с помощью запросов к базе данных.

Из формы с информацией о сотруднике можно перейти к стартовой форме, нажав соответствующую кнопку. Кроме того, в ней можно пролистывать записи базы данных, вносить изменения в базу, создавать новые записи о сотрудника и удалять записи. При обновлении в базу посылается SQL запрос на обновление данных и все поля базы обновляются. При успешном обновлении появляется сообщение. При добавлении новой записи в базу данных посылается запрос на добавление записи и вносится новый PersonID сотрудника, после чего вызывается обновление этой записи, тем самым производятся изменения всех полей записи. При удалении записи посылается запрос на удаление и производится переход на соседнюю запись. Если в базе записей нет, то появляется сообщение об этом и форма закрывается.


5. Авторские находки

Для того, чтобы еще более автоматизировать своё приложение, и сделать проще доступ к нему, я решил создать отдельное автономное приложение, из которого можно открыть все файлы данной курсовой работы. И я написал .exe файл, из которого можно открыть файл моего чертежа AutoCAD, файл базы данных Access и этот файл отчёта. Внешний вид программы:


6. Список литературы

1. Полещук Н.Н. AutoCAD: разработка приложений, настройка и адаптация. СПб.: БХВ-Петербург, 2006 - 992 c.: ил.

2. Погорелов В.И. AutoCAD 2007. Экспресс-курс. СПб.: БХВ-Петербург, 2006 - 560 c.: ил.

К-во Просмотров: 573
Бесплатно скачать Курсовая работа: Разработка прикладного программного обеспечения отдела кадров университета